B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to an electric connection box fixing structure for fixing an electric connection box, which is screwed on one side to a vehicle body support portion and inserted on the other side into the vehicle body, to the vehicle body.

2. Description of the Related Art FIG. 5 and FIG.
No. 74 discloses a fixing structure of an electric connection box. FIG.
1 shows a state in which the connector 1 is fixed to the vehicle body 3. From both sides of the connector 1, mounting feet 5, 7 are respectively protruded, and these mounting feet 5, 7 are provided with screw insertion holes 9, 11, respectively. On the other hand, columnar bosses 13 are protruded from the vehicle body 3. The bosses 13 are formed with screw holes 17 into which the screws 15 are respectively screwed.

[0003] Screws 15 are inserted into the screw insertion holes 9 and 11.
15, the connector 1 is fixed to the vehicle body 3 by screwing it into the screw holes 17, 17 of the bosses 13, 13, and tightening.

However, in this fixing structure, the two screws 15, 15 are aligned with the screw holes 17, 17 of the bosses 13, 13 and tightened, so that the work is troublesome and the workability is poor. is there.

Therefore, as shown in FIG. 6, a rib insertion hole 19 is formed in one of the mounting feet 7, and the rib insertion hole 19 is formed.
Then, a structure is proposed in which a positioning rib 13a provided at the tip of a boss 13 is inserted and the other mounting foot 5 is screwed to fix the connector 1 to the vehicle body 3.

According to this structure, the connector 1 can be easily fixed to the vehicle body 3 by screwing one screw 15 into the screw hole 17 of the boss 13 and tightening it. Mounting workability is improved.

However, in the fixing structure shown in FIG.
There is a problem that the mounting foot portion 7 fixed to 9 vibrates up and down, so that the connector 1 cannot be securely fixed to the vehicle body 3.

For this reason, the upper surface side of the boss 13 on the screwing side is inclined, a gap 20 is provided between the upper surface of the boss 13 and the mounting foot 5, and the screw 15 is tightened. Although the ribs 13a are prevented from falling out from inside, in this case, the ribs 13a are merely inserted into the rib insertion holes 19, so that the ribs 13a are easily pulled out, and the vibration of the vehicle body tends to cause play.

Therefore, the present invention provides an electric connection box on a vehicle body,
An object of the present invention is to provide a fixing structure of an electric junction box which can be fixed easily and surely.
